Tips for Independent Artists to Maximize Royalties from Performance Rights

Independent artists often face challenges when it comes to earning royalties from their performances. Understanding how to maximize these earnings is crucial for sustaining a career in music or other performing arts. Here are some practical tips to help artists optimize their performance rights royalties.

Understand Performance Rights Organizations (PROs)

Performance Rights Organizations (PROs) like ASCAP, BMI, and SOCAN play a vital role in collecting and distributing royalties for public performances of your work. Registering with the appropriate PRO ensures you receive the royalties you’re owed whenever your music is played publicly.

Register Your Works Properly

Accurate registration of your compositions with your PRO is essential. Include detailed information such as song titles, co-writers, and publishing splits. Proper registration prevents missed payments and ensures you get the full amount owed.

Monitor Your Royalties Regularly

Keep track of your royalty statements and earnings. Many PROs offer online dashboards where you can monitor performance data. Regular monitoring helps identify discrepancies early and ensures you receive all the royalties you deserve.

Explore Additional Revenue Streams

Besides performance royalties, consider licensing your music for commercials, films, or video games. These opportunities can provide additional income streams and increase your overall earnings from your creative work.
